Richmans Enginehouse

Historical Sites and Heritage Locations

Richmans concentrating plant operated from 1869 until the mine closed in 1923, crushing and concentrating ore from nearby shafts. During this period many alterations were made to the plant to suit the improved technology of mining and processing.

The walk around provides access to Richmans Engine house and signs interpret the remaining structures. Richmans Enginehouse is in the Moonta Mines National Heritage Area. Richmans Enginehouse is able to be viewed from the parking area. Newly upgraded and reopened steps allow access up the nearby 20 metre high skimping burrow (tailing heap) which gives spectacular views of the area.
